In 1916, only Slim Sallee of the St. Louis Cardinals had both as few earned runs (27) and gave up as many hits per nine innings (9.6).

closest were Joe Boehling of the Cleveland Indians (18, 9.3), Jing Johnson of the Philadelphia Athletics (35, 9.6), Milt Watson of the St. Louis Cardinals (35, 9.5), and Earl Hamilton of the St. Louis Browns (35, 9.5), ending with Eddie Plank of the St. Louis Browns (61, 7.8).

Profile

Slim Sallee of the 1916 St. Louis Cardinals threw left-handed, played on a losing team, played in Robison Field, and was born in Ohio.
